I love leeks but hasn't had any luck with them in my system. How from seed/seedling to get to that stage? Did you buy seedlings or plant seed directly in GB?

Author:  Ryan [ Apr 20th, '11, 04:14 ]
Post subject:  Re: LEEKS!!!

Thx guys :)

Stuart- Thats about 3.5 months from seed (Directly sown into the bed). I thinned them out about a month and a half ago when they were the size of green onions.

Author:  Double Decker [ Jul 23rd, '11, 10:26 ]
Post subject:  Re: LEEKS!!!

DONT pick the leeks out of the bed just cut them off 1 inch above gravel and they will grow back.... you will see the centre starting to grow by later that day or early the next day..... I have cut some leeks 2-3 times so far
and even transplanted them after just shallots ..... never pull the whole lot out it will save you a heap of seedling growing time... happy growing... :)
